Transmitter and associated calibration method

A transmitter, comprising: a power amplifier, configured to receive an input signal to generate an amplified input signal, wherein the amplified input signal is a differential signal; a transformer, configured to receive the amplified input signal to generate an output signal; a first adjusting circuit, configured to adjust a phase and an amplitude of a common mode signal of the amplified input signal to generate a first signal; a coupling circuit, configured to generate a coupled signal to the output signal according to the first signal; a control circuit, configured to control the first adjusting circuit to have a plurality of combinations in sequence, wherein the plurality of combinations comprise different phase and amplitude adjustments of the first adjusting circuit, respectively; and a harmonic intensity calculation circuit, wherein for the first adjusting circuit having any one of the combinations, the harmonic intensity calculation circuit calculates an intensity of a second harmonic of the output signal, so that the harmonic intensity calculation circuit generates a plurality of intensities of the second harmonics respectively corresponding to the plurality of combinations; wherein the control circuit further determines a specific combination among the plurality of combinations based on the plurality of intensities of the second harmonics corresponding to the plurality of combinations.
